If you are the parent or guardian of a student living in Clackamas County and you plan to home school your child, you must register with Clackamas ESD within 10 days of beginning home schooling, withdrawing the child from school or moving here from a different Education Service District (ESD) region. Learn more about the Oregon Department of Education (ODE)’s home schooling guidelines.

Register your child for home schooling in Clackamas County

Clackamas ESD also accepts written notification of intent to home school.

Complete the Home School Notification form and mail it to:

Clackamas Education Service District
Attn: Home School Office
13455 SE 97th Ave
Clackamas, OR 97015
